Why is there no NHL team in Cleveland?
The NHL in Cleveland was short-lived due to limited marketing, poor play, and a strangling lease. This is not proof in the pudding, as some would say, that the NHL doesn’t fit in Cleveland. The Barons were setup to fail from the get-go.
What happened to the Cleveland Barons NHL team?
The Barons fared no better in 1977-78, at one point embarking on a fifteen game winless streak, and following that season, they were merged with the Minnesota North Stars (now the Dallas Stars). Professional hockey disappeared from the Cleveland metropolitan area until 1993 when the CLEVELAND LUMBERJACKS began play.

Does Ohio have a hockey team?
Columbus Blue Jackets, American professional ice hockey team based in Columbus, Ohio, that plays in the Eastern Conference of the National Hockey League (NHL). The Blue Jackets joined the NHL in 2000 alongside fellow expansion team the Minnesota Wild.
Are the Cleveland Monsters in the NHL?
The Cleveland Monsters are a professional ice hockey team in the American Hockey League (AHL). The team began play in 2007 as the Lake Erie Monsters and since 2015 has served as the top affiliate of the Columbus Blue Jackets of the National Hockey League (NHL).
Does Cleveland have a minor league hockey team?
The Cleveland Monsters are an ice hockey team in the American Hockey League. They began play in the 2007–08 AHL season at the Quicken Loans Arena in Cleveland, Ohio. The team is the minor league affiliate of the Columbus Blue Jackets of the NHL.

Does Cincinnati have a hockey team?
The Cincinnati Cyclones are a professional ice hockey team based in Cincinnati, Ohio. The team is a member of the ECHL. Originally established in 1990, the team first played their games in the Cincinnati Gardens and now play at Heritage Bank Center.
Does Cleveland still have a hockey team?
While there hasn’t been a NHL team in Cleveland since 1978 (the Barons), the city is reasonably close of a number of current clubs, namely Columbus, Detroit, Buffalo and Pittsburgh.” — Pro Hockey…
